This room for rent is located on Saigondreef in Utrecht and offers a living space of approximately 24 square meters. The room is unfurnished with uncarpeted flooring, providing a neutral base for personal furnishing and decoration. A notable feature of the layout is the private bathroom and private toilet, both situated within the room itself, allowing for an independent and self-contained living arrangement. There is no separate living room or kitchen included with the space.
The room is positioned at the rear of the property, facing the back garden, which provides a pleasant outlook directly onto the outdoor area. Internet is available within the room, supporting connectivity for study or work needs. The energy label is listed as unknown. There are no other roommates in the accommodation, ensuring a single-tenant setup.
The rent is set at €550 per month, with utilities included in this amount. No deposit or additional costs are specified. The landlord specifies an ideal tenant profile: a single female occupant between the ages of 19 and 35, without pets. Acceptable occupations include students, working students, or working professionals. The landlord requires the tenant to speak Dutch. The intended duration of stay is two years or more.
The accommodation is available from 4 September 2026 until 4 September 2027. It is suited for one tenant seeking a private, independent room in Utrecht with essential facilities such as a shower, toilet, and internet access. The garden-facing position and the inclusion of utilities in the rent make this a practical option for long-term stays within the specified tenant criteria.

Does the displayed rent include utilities and service costs?
Not necessarily. Luntero shows the price and cost details supplied by the listing source, but inclusions vary by property. Check the full cost breakdown on the original source before applying, including service costs, gas, electricity, water, internet, parking, and any one-off fees.
Which documents will I need to apply?
Requirements are set by the landlord or listing provider, not Luntero. The original listing or application form should give the definitive checklist. It may include identification, proof of income or employment, student documents, or guarantor information, but do not send sensitive documents until you have checked who is requesting them and why.
Can Luntero tell me the status of my application?
No. Applications are completed with the original listing provider, so Luntero cannot see whether your application was received, shortlisted, rejected, or invited for a viewing. Contact the provider through the details in your application confirmation or on the original listing page.
Can Luntero arrange a viewing or contact the owner for me?
No. Luntero does not own or manage the property and does not have a private contact channel to its owner. Use the original source button on the listing page to view the provider's application and contact options. If public owner or agency contact details are available, they are shown on the listing page.
Why do details sometimes differ from the original listing?
A provider may update or remove a listing after Luntero last collected it. The original source is the final reference for availability, price, conditions, and application instructions. If the pages disagree, rely on the source and report the Luntero listing so it can be reviewed.
Where do I find the original listing and application page?
Open the Luntero listing and look for the 'View listing' source buttons. They identify the platform the listing came from and open its original page in a new tab. Apply there; Luntero does not accept rental applications.
How do I report an unavailable, incorrect, duplicate, or suspicious listing?
Open the listing and select 'Report an issue'. Choose the closest reason and add any useful details. Reports help Luntero review its copy of the listing; for an urgent issue involving the application itself, also contact the original platform.
